Actress Dipika Kakar is best known for her role in Sasural Simar Ka and for winning Bigg Boss 12. She appeared on a podcast with Bharti Singh and Haarsh Limbachiyaa, where she discussed her decision to
enter Bigg Bossand whether she regrets it.
The actress also opened up about her treatment after she underwent tumour-removal surgery for her stage 2 liver cancer.
Dipika Kakar On Entering Bigg Boss 12
During the podcast, when Bharti asked her whether she doubted her decision after joining the show, she shared, “Nahi, kyun aayi nahi hua. Honestly, main jhoot nahi bolungi, main agar kisi cheez mein ghus ti hoon na, to main bahut door tak soch kar jaati hoon.”
She added, “Mujhe jab Bigg Boss pehli baar offer kiya gaya tha, toh pehla sawal yeh tha ki aap kyun mana kar rahi ho. Kyunki main chaar saal se mana kar rahi thi. Phir main gayi thi.”

Dipika Kakar Reveals What Was Her Weak Point During Bigg Boss
The actress revealed she had only one weak point at that time, her husband Shoaib Ibrahim, with whom she had just gotten married.
She shared, “My only weak point was that my communication with Shoaib would break. That was my only weakness. Mujhe aur koi farak nahi padhta. Mujhe koi aake kuch keh le, lad le, haan, main physical fight mein nahi ghusungi. Isliye jab bhi nonsense kuch hota tha, toh main peeche khadi ho jaati thi. Bhai, main dimaag se jitna bolo lad lungi, but mujhe 2-3 ladko ke beech khicha-tani nahi karni thi. That’s not my personality. Toh yeh mere liye ek bada challenge tha.”
Dipika Kakar On Her Post-Surgery Treatment
The actress underwent surgery in June to remove a tumour caused by stage 2 liver cancer. Dipika shared that the procedure successfully eliminated the cancerous cells, and since then, her recovery has been closely monitored through regular blood and tumour marker tests.
She said, “However, I’m currently on oral targeted therapy, which works somewhat like chemotherapy. This treatment will continue for two years, during which we’ll stay vigilant to ensure there’s no recurrence. That’s why periodic scans are necessary to keep everything in check.”
In 2018, Shoaib and Dipika tied the knot in a nikah ceremony. The couple have a two-year-old son, Ruhaan.
